Headstones, fence vandalized at cemetery in southeast Nebraska, sheriff’s office says

LINCOLN, Neb. (KLKN) – The Gage County Sheriff’s Office is investigating after headstones were damaged at a cemetery in Blue Springs.

A caller reported damage to two headstones and a fence on Jan. 19, according to a Facebook post.

The sheriff’s office said Monday that vehicle tracks were seen leaving the roadway and entering the cemetery.

Deputies also recovered pieces of a grille suspected to be from the same vehicle, according to the sheriff’s office.

The photo shared by the sheriff’s office suggests that the vehicle ran into the headstones, toppling them.

Anyone with information is asked to call the Gage County Sheriff’s Office at 402-223-5222 or Crime Stoppers at 402-228-4343.
